trailer break: ‘The Haunting in Connecticut’

Take a break from work: watch a trailer...


The message: Don’t sleep in the basement!

Oh, you know, why don’t the dead just die already? Don’t they know they’re really pissing us off?

Also: Connecticut? So not scary. Unless your talking about real estate prices in Greenwich.

The Haunting in Connecticut opens in the U.S. and the U.K. on March 27.
